Types of Environmental Pollution

Environmental pollution can be categorized into several types, each with its unique characteristics and implications. The primary types include air pollution, water pollution, soil pollution, noise pollution, and light pollution. Each type of pollution has distinct sources and consequences, which necessitate targeted approaches for mitigation.

Air Pollution

Air pollution refers to the presence of harmful substances in the atmosphere, which can be in the form of gases, particulates, or biological molecules. Common pollutants include carbon monoxide, sulfur dioxide, nitrogen oxides, ozone, and particulate matter. These pollutants can originate from various sources, including vehicles, industrial processes, and even natural phenomena.

The sources of air pollution are diverse, ranging from industrial emissions and vehicle exhaust to natural events such as wildfires and volcanic eruptions. Urban areas are particularly vulnerable due to high population density and industrial activities. The concentration of pollutants in cities often exceeds safe levels, leading to smog and health advisories.

The effects of air pollution are profound, contributing to respiratory diseases, cardiovascular problems, and even premature death. Additionally, air pollution has significant environmental impacts, including acid rain and climate change. The long-term exposure to polluted air can lead to chronic health conditions, affecting millions of people worldwide.

Water Pollution

Water pollution occurs when harmful contaminants are introduced into water bodies, including rivers, lakes, oceans, and groundwater. Major sources of water pollution include industrial discharge, agricultural runoff, sewage disposal, and plastic waste. The introduction of these pollutants can severely disrupt aquatic ecosystems and the organisms that inhabit them.

Contaminants can include heavy metals, pesticides, pathogens, and nutrients that lead to eutrophication. The consequences of water pollution are dire, affecting aquatic life, disrupting ecosystems, and posing serious health risks to humans who rely on contaminated water sources. For instance, the presence of heavy metals in drinking water can lead to neurological disorders and developmental issues in children.

Soil Pollution

Soil pollution is the degradation of soil quality due to the presence of toxic chemicals, waste, and other pollutants. Common sources include agricultural practices, industrial activities, and improper waste disposal. The accumulation of these pollutants can lead to a decline in soil fertility, which is essential for food production.

Soil pollutants can lead to a decline in soil fertility, affecting food production and ecosystem health. Contaminated soil can also leach toxins into groundwater, further exacerbating water pollution issues. The long-term effects of soil pollution can result in reduced agricultural yields and increased food insecurity.

Noise Pollution

Noise pollution is the excessive or harmful levels of noise in the environment, primarily caused by transportation, industrial activities, and urbanization. It can lead to various health issues, including stress, hearing loss, and sleep disturbances. The constant exposure to high noise levels can have detrimental effects on mental health and overall well-being.

Noise pollution also affects wildlife, disrupting communication, mating, and feeding behaviors. The impact on biodiversity is significant, as many species are sensitive to noise and may be driven away from their natural habitats. This disruption can lead to a decline in species populations and alter ecosystem dynamics.

Light Pollution

Light pollution refers to the excessive or misdirected artificial light that brightens the night sky, disrupting ecosystems and human circadian rhythms. Sources include streetlights, advertising signs, and residential lighting. The over-illumination of urban areas can obscure the visibility of stars and disrupt the natural behaviors of nocturnal animals.

The effects of light pollution are far-reaching, impacting nocturnal wildlife, disrupting migration patterns, and affecting human health by interfering with sleep patterns and increasing the risk of certain diseases. Studies have shown that exposure to artificial light at night can lead to hormonal imbalances and increased risks of obesity and depression.

Causes of Environmental Pollution

The causes of environmental pollution are multifaceted and often interrelated. Understanding these causes is crucial for developing effective strategies to combat pollution. Many of these causes stem from human activities that prioritize economic growth over environmental sustainability.

Industrialization

Industrialization has significantly contributed to environmental pollution. The rapid growth of industries has led to increased emissions of pollutants into the air, water, and soil. Factories often discharge waste without adequate treatment, leading to severe environmental degradation. The demand for cheap and fast production often results in neglecting environmental regulations.

Urbanization

Urbanization results in higher population densities, increased waste generation, and greater demand for resources. Cities often struggle with waste management, leading to pollution of land and water bodies. The infrastructure in many urban areas is not equipped to handle the volume of waste generated, resulting in overflowing landfills and polluted waterways.

Agricultural Practices

Modern agricultural practices, including the use of chemical fertilizers and pesticides, contribute to soil and water pollution. Runoff from agricultural fields can carry these chemicals into nearby water bodies, leading to eutrophication and harm to aquatic life. The reliance on monoculture and intensive farming practices further exacerbates the problem, depleting soil health and biodiversity.

Transportation

The transportation sector is a major contributor to air pollution. Emissions from vehicles, airplanes, and ships release harmful pollutants into the atmosphere, exacerbating health problems and contributing to climate change. The increasing reliance on fossil fuels for transportation continues to pose significant challenges for air quality and public health.

Waste Disposal

Improper waste disposal practices, including landfilling and incineration, can lead to soil and water pollution. Landfills can leach toxic substances into the ground, while incineration can release harmful emissions into the air. The lack of effective recycling programs and waste management strategies further complicates the issue, leading to increased pollution levels.

Effects of Environmental Pollution

The effects of environmental pollution are extensive and can be categorized into health impacts, ecological consequences, and economic costs. Each of these effects has far-reaching implications for society and the environment.

Health Impacts

Environmental pollution poses significant risks to human health. Air pollution is linked to respiratory diseases, cardiovascular problems, and increased mortality rates. Water pollution can lead to gastrointestinal diseases, reproductive issues, and neurological disorders. Vulnerable populations, such as children and the elderly, are particularly at risk from these health impacts.

Soil pollution can affect food safety, as contaminated crops can pose health risks to consumers. Additionally, noise pollution is associated with stress, anxiety, and sleep disturbances. The cumulative effects of these health impacts can strain healthcare systems and reduce quality of life for affected individuals.

Ecological Consequences

Pollution disrupts ecosystems and threatens biodiversity. Air and water pollution can lead to habitat destruction and loss of species. Eutrophication caused by nutrient runoff can create dead zones in aquatic environments, where oxygen levels are too low to support life. The loss of biodiversity can destabilize ecosystems, making them more vulnerable to environmental changes.

Soil pollution can reduce soil fertility, impacting plant growth and agricultural productivity. The cumulative effects of pollution can lead to irreversible changes in ecosystems, resulting in the loss of natural resources and ecosystem services that are vital for human survival.

Economic Costs

The economic costs of environmental pollution are substantial. Healthcare costs associated with pollution-related diseases can burden public health systems. Additionally, pollution can negatively impact industries such as agriculture, tourism, and fisheries, leading to job losses and reduced economic growth. The long-term economic implications of pollution can hinder sustainable development and exacerbate poverty.

Solutions to Environmental Pollution

Addressing environmental pollution requires a multifaceted approach involving government policies, technological innovations, and individual actions. Each of these solutions plays a critical role in creating a sustainable future.

Government Policies

Governments play a crucial role in regulating pollution through legislation and enforcement. Implementing stricter emissions standards, promoting renewable energy, and investing in public transportation can significantly reduce pollution levels. Policies that incentivize sustainable practices and penalize polluters are essential for driving change.

International cooperation is also essential, as pollution knows no borders. Agreements such as the Paris Agreement aim to address global environmental issues collectively. Collaborative efforts among nations can lead to more effective strategies for reducing pollution and protecting the environment.

Technological Innovations

Advancements in technology can provide solutions to pollution. Innovations in waste management, such as recycling and composting, can reduce landfill waste. Clean energy technologies, including solar and wind power, can decrease reliance on fossil fuels and reduce air pollution. The development of biodegradable materials can also help mitigate plastic pollution.

Furthermore, pollution control technologies, such as scrubbers and filters, can be implemented in industries to minimize emissions. Research and development in green technologies are crucial for creating sustainable alternatives to traditional practices.

Individual Actions

Individuals can contribute to reducing pollution through conscious lifestyle choices. Reducing energy consumption, using public transportation, and minimizing waste can collectively make a significant impact. Simple actions, such as using reusable bags and bottles, can help decrease plastic waste and promote sustainability.

Raising awareness about environmental issues and advocating for sustainable practices can also drive change at the community and policy levels. Grassroots movements and community initiatives can empower individuals to take action and influence decision-makers to prioritize environmental protection.
